#bestvacationever
A poem for the humorous poetry contest

The flowers out back were beginning to bloom
My family and I in our living room

Baby birds outside were learning to sing
My daughter’s iTouch was starting to ping

Me on my iPad, deep in the zone
The fam’ on the couch, glued to their phones

“What's 4 din,” I texted my wife
“I’ll order 🍕,” she tapped her device

I e-mailed my boy, “Is your homework all done?”
“It Sprg Br8k,” replied my son

“smh…girl ain’t got no butt for that dress”
To Facebook my daughter posted that mess

I looked around and shook my head
For this isn’t living, it’s more like we’re dead

I decided to give them each a mandate
So to their walls, I tagged an update

“We shall go camping, starting tomorrow”
I then heard a gasp of guttural horror

“We shall depart at O five thirty”
“The tweets we'll get will be from birdies”

I got no comment, not even a like
So to our agenda, I added a hike

“#lamedad makes family sleep in a tent”
To the internet, that's what was sent

Deep in the mountains odd things transpired
As 4G networks failed to acquire

Around a fire, my son spoke real words
And he and my daughter even conferred

We fished, we biked, and told spooky stories
I rehashed tales of all my past glories

My wife rubbed my knee, cut her eyes to our van
For she had devised an intimate plan

We took lots of pics of our happy fam’
So we could all post to Instagram
